With a Delta E of 13.1, these colors are very different. Both colors belong to the Red hue family. RAL 010 60 35 has a neutral temperature while RAL 030 50 30 has a warm temperature. RAL 010 60 35 is brighter with an LRV of 25.1 compared to 16.5 for RAL 030 50 30. RAL 010 60 35 is more saturated (38%) than RAL 030 50 30 (25%).
